Output 41bbebaabe4da055fae2dfaece88656c7658ac1eec88cabce700f45a6ec3fae7:0

value
416800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85655ae619b50059e342447b8052f4fa6f1dfe6f OP_EQUAL
address
3DrMDLAJoK8uLfbzjawxWxt6TUnALLBEU5
transaction
41bbebaabe4da055fae2dfaece88656c7658ac1eec88cabce700f45a6ec3fae7
confirmations
364958
spent
true